The coldest biome on Earth's surface is the tundra. This biome has long, cold winters with temperatures dropping below freezing, and short, cool summers. The tundra is characterized by low biodiversity and a layer of permafrost beneath the surface.

Albedo refers to the reflectivity of a surface. Surfaces with high albedo reflect more solar radiation back into space, which can cool the Earth's surface and lower temperatures. Surfaces with low albedo absorb more solar radiation, leading to warming of the Earth's surface.
When magma reaches the Earth's surface, it is called lava. Lava can flow out of a volcano during an eruption and can cool to form igneous rocks. The characteristics of the lava, such as its temperature and composition, can influence the type of volcanic eruption that occurs.
